What's Happening?
Elon Musk's Terafab AI chip project in Austin, Texas, is set to receive significant support from Intel. The American chipmaker announced its involvement in designing and constructing the facility, which
aims to supply AI chips to Musk's companies, SpaceX and Tesla. These chips are crucial for Musk's plans to develop self-driving cars, humanoid robots, and data centers. The partnership with Intel alleviates some of the pressure on Musk, who has expressed concerns about the chip-making industry's ability to meet demand. Intel's experience in chip fabrication is expected to accelerate the project's progress, with the goal of producing 1 terawatt of computing power annually.
Why It's Important?
The collaboration between Intel and Musk's Terafab project highlights the growing demand for AI chips in the tech industry. As AI applications expand, the need for advanced semiconductor technology becomes critical. This partnership could enhance the U.S. semiconductor manufacturing capabilities, reducing reliance on foreign producers like Taiwan Semiconductor Manufacturing Company. The project also represents a significant investment in domestic chip production, potentially boosting the U.S. economy and technological innovation. However, Intel's involvement comes amid its own challenges in completing other fabrication plants, raising questions about the timeline and feasibility of the Terafab project.
